Marijuana and some cannabis-infused products (CBD oil), … WebJun 17, 2024 · MAKE YOUR OWN LOTIONS AND BALMS. Cannabis topicals have become enormously popular. With that in mind, another great way to use leftover fan leaves from your harvest is to make your own cannabis balms and lotions. The simplest way to make a topical using fan leaves is to steep them in hot coconut oil for 1–3 hours.
